38、,- UL COPYRIGHTED MATERIAL NOT AUTHORIZED FOR FURTHER REPRODUCTION OR DISTRIBUTION WITHOUT PERMISSION FROM UL INTRODUCTION 1 Scope 1.1 These requirements cover tests to determine combustibility and the amount of smoke generated for air fi lter units of both washable and throwaway types used for remo

39、val of dust and other airborne particles from air circulated mechanically in equipment and systems installed in accordance with the Standards for Installation of Air Conditioning and Ventilating Systems, NFPA 90A (Other Than Residence Type), and for Installation of Warm Air Heating and Air Condition

40、ing Systems, NFPA 90B (Residence Type). 1.2 Since the combustibility and smoke generation of an air fi lter unit, after a period of service, depends upon the nature and quantity of the material collected by the fi lter, the test requirements of this standard, for classifi cation purposes, apply only

41、 to air fi lter units in a clean condition. Consequently, when fi lters are susceptible to the accumulation of combustible deposits, it is intended that maintenance and inspection practices should be followed as proposed in Appendix B of NFPA 90A. 2 Classifi cations 2.1 Air fi lter units covered by

42、this standard are classifi ed as follows: a) Class 1 Units Those that, when clean, do not contribute fuel when attacked by fl ame and emit only negligible amounts of smoke. b) Class 2 Units Those that, when clean, burn moderately when attacked by fl ame or emit moderate amounts of smoke, or both. 3

43、Units of measurement 3.1 Values stated without parentheses are the requirement. Values in parentheses are explanatory or approximate information. 4 Undated References 4.1 Any undated reference to a code or standard appearing in the requirements of this standard shall be interpreted as referring to t

44、he latest edition of that code or standard. SEPTEMBER 2, 2004AIR FILTER UNITS - UL 9004 -,-,- UL COPYRIGHTED MATERIAL NOT AUTHORIZED FOR FURTHER REPRODUCTION OR DISTRIBUTION WITHOUT PERMISSION FROM UL 5 General 5.1 Air fi lter units shall not contain unbonded asbestos fi ber materials. PERFORMANCE 6

45、 Performance Requirements 6.1 A Class 1 air fi lter unit shall not produce fl ame or sparks when subjected to the Flame-Exposure Test, Section 7. During the fl ame-exposure test, the Class 1 air fi lter unit shall not cause the development of an area of more than 16.1 cm2(2-1/2 square inches) as mea

46、sured below the smoke-density time curve. 6.2 When tested as specifi ed in Section 8, Spot-Flame Test, the upstream face of a Class 1 fi lter shall not continue to fl ame after removal of the test fl ame. 6.3 A Class 2 air fi lter unit shall not produce fl ame or extensive (25 or more) sparks which

47、are sustained beyond the discharge end of the test duct when subjected to the fl ame-exposure test and shall not cause the development of an area of more than 58 cm2(9 square inches) as measured below the smoke-density time curve. 6.4 An adhesive material used for coating the fi ltering medium or ot

48、her part of an air fi lter unit shall have a fl ash point of not less than 163C (325F) as determined by the Test Method for Flash and Fire Points by Cleveland Open Cup, ASTM D92. 7 Flame-Exposure Test 7.1 The fl ame-exposure test apparatus is to consist of an air duct provided with means for supporting a sample air fi lter unit and to expose the air fi lter unit to an igniting fl ame under controlled conditions of air velocity.
